Quick Jump
Order orchestration is a critical component of eCommerce fulfillment. It refers to the process of managing and coordinating the various steps involved in fulfilling an online order. This includes everything from the moment an order is placed on a website, through to its delivery to the customer. The goal of order orchestration is to ensure that orders are processed quickly, efficiently, and accurately, leading to improved customer satisfaction and increased profitability for the business.
Given the complexity of eCommerce fulfillment, order orchestration is often facilitated by specialized software solutions. These systems help to automate and streamline the various stages of the order fulfillment process, reducing the potential for errors and delays. This article will delve into the various aspects of order orchestration, providing a comprehensive understanding of this crucial eCommerce concept.
Understanding the Order Orchestration Process
The order orchestration process begins when a customer places an order on an eCommerce website. The order then goes through several stages before it is finally delivered to the customer. These stages can vary depending on the specific business model and the nature of the products being sold, but they generally include order capture, inventory allocation, order picking, packing, shipping, and delivery.
Each of these stages requires careful coordination and management to ensure that the order is fulfilled accurately and on time. This is where order orchestration comes into play. It provides a framework for managing these various stages, ensuring that each step is completed in the correct sequence and within the required time frame.
Order Capture
Order capture is the first stage of the order orchestration process. This involves recording the details of the customer's order, including the products ordered, the quantity, the delivery address, and the payment information. This information is then used to initiate the fulfillment process.
Order capture can be facilitated by a variety of technologies, including eCommerce platforms, shopping cart software, and order management systems. These systems help to automate the order capture process, reducing the potential for errors and ensuring that orders are processed quickly and efficiently.
Inventory Allocation
Once an order has been captured, the next stage is inventory allocation. This involves reserving the ordered items from the business's inventory to fulfill the order. Inventory allocation is a critical step in the order orchestration process, as it ensures that the business has the necessary stock to fulfill the order.
Inventory allocation can be a complex process, particularly for businesses that maintain multiple warehouses or fulfillment centers. In such cases, the order orchestration system must determine which location is best suited to fulfill the order, based on factors such as the proximity to the customer and the availability of stock.
Order Picking and Packing
Once the inventory has been allocated, the next stage is order picking. This involves retrieving the ordered items from the warehouse or fulfillment center and preparing them for shipment. The order picking process can be facilitated by a variety of technologies, including barcode scanners, mobile devices, and warehouse management systems.
After the order has been picked, it is then packed for shipment. This involves placing the items in a shipping container, adding any necessary packing materials, and attaching the shipping label. The packing process must be carefully managed to ensure that the items are protected during transit and arrive at the customer's location in good condition.
Shipping and Delivery
Once the order has been packed, it is then ready for shipping. The order orchestration system coordinates with the shipping provider to arrange for the pickup and delivery of the order. This involves transmitting the necessary shipping information to the provider, including the delivery address and the shipping method.
The final stage of the order orchestration process is delivery. This involves transporting the order to the customer's location and confirming that it has been received. The delivery process can be facilitated by a variety of technologies, including GPS tracking, mobile apps, and delivery management systems.
Challenges in Order Orchestration
While order orchestration can greatly streamline the eCommerce fulfillment process, it is not without its challenges. One of the primary challenges is managing the complexity of the process. With so many stages and variables to consider, it can be difficult to ensure that every order is processed accurately and on time.
Another challenge is integrating the various technologies that facilitate the order orchestration process. This can include eCommerce platforms, order management systems, warehouse management systems, and shipping providers. Each of these systems must be able to communicate and share data effectively in order to ensure a seamless order fulfillment process.
Managing Inventory
Managing inventory is another major challenge in order orchestration. Businesses must ensure that they have sufficient stock to fulfill orders, while also avoiding overstocking which can lead to increased storage costs and potential waste. This requires accurate forecasting and inventory management, which can be facilitated by advanced analytics and inventory management systems.
Furthermore, businesses that operate multiple warehouses or fulfillment centers must also manage the allocation of inventory across these locations. This can be a complex task, particularly when dealing with high volumes of orders and a diverse range of products.
Customer Expectations
Meeting customer expectations is another challenge in order orchestration. Today's customers expect fast, reliable delivery, and any delays or errors in the order fulfillment process can lead to dissatisfaction and lost sales. Therefore, businesses must strive to provide a seamless, efficient order fulfillment experience to meet these expectations.
This requires not only efficient order orchestration but also effective communication with customers. Businesses must provide timely and accurate updates on the status of orders, and be able to respond quickly and effectively to any issues or queries that may arise.
Benefits of Effective Order Orchestration
Despite these challenges, effective order orchestration can provide a range of benefits for businesses. One of the primary benefits is improved efficiency. By streamlining and automating the order fulfillment process, businesses can reduce the time and effort required to process orders, leading to increased productivity and profitability.
Another benefit is improved accuracy. By reducing the potential for human error and ensuring that each stage of the process is completed in the correct sequence, businesses can reduce the risk of errors and delays in the order fulfillment process. This can lead to improved customer satisfaction and increased repeat business.
Customer Satisfaction
Improved customer satisfaction is another key benefit of effective order orchestration. By ensuring that orders are processed quickly, accurately, and efficiently, businesses can meet or exceed customer expectations, leading to increased customer loyalty and repeat business.
Furthermore, by providing timely and accurate updates on the status of orders, businesses can enhance their customer service and build stronger relationships with their customers. This can lead to increased customer retention and a higher lifetime value for each customer.
Scalability
Effective order orchestration can also provide scalability for businesses. As a business grows and the volume of orders increases, the complexity of the order fulfillment process also increases. By automating and streamlining this process, businesses can more easily scale their operations to meet this increased demand.
This can be particularly beneficial for businesses that experience seasonal fluctuations in demand, as it allows them to scale up their operations during peak periods without the need for significant additional resources or infrastructure.
Conclusion
In conclusion, order orchestration is a critical component of eCommerce fulfillment. It involves managing and coordinating the various stages of the order fulfillment process, from order capture through to delivery. While it can be complex and challenging, effective order orchestration can provide a range of benefits for businesses, including improved efficiency, accuracy, customer satisfaction, and scalability.
By understanding the various aspects of order orchestration and implementing effective strategies and technologies, businesses can enhance their eCommerce fulfillment capabilities and achieve greater success in the online marketplace.
Ready to take your eCommerce fulfillment to the next level? With Fulfill, you can effortlessly connect with the perfect third-party logistics (3PL) provider to enhance your order orchestration. Our platform is designed to simplify your search for a logistics partner that aligns with your business needs, ensuring your operations are as efficient and customer-focused as possible. Discover Your Ideal Logistics Partner today and start building a supply chain that scales with your success.